What is Mesothelioma?
Mesothelioma is a rare however extremely aggressive type of cancer that the majority of commonly affects the lining of the lungs (pleural mesothelioma) but can also impact the abdominal area (peritoneal mesothelioma) and heart (pericardial mesothelioma). Symptoms frequently consist of consistent cough, chest pain, shortness of breath, and unusual weight reduction. 2. Causes and Risk Factors
The primary reason for mesothelioma is exposure to asbestos. The following markets and activities are known for asbestos exposure:
IndustryExposure SourcesConstructionInsulation, roofing materials, and flooring itemsShipbuildingInsulation around equipment and ship hullsAutomotiveBrake pads, clutches, and insulationOil and gasPipeline insulation and refineriesProductionNumerous products consisting of asbestos
Individuals who operated in these markets or coped with someone who dealt with asbestos are at a heightened risk of developing mesothelioma.

Submitting a mesothelioma lawsuit in Louisiana includes several crucial actions:

Consult a legal representative: It is important to deal with legal counsel experienced in mesothelioma cases. They can provide assistance and help browse the procedure, examine the claim's merits, and estimate possible compensation.

Collect proof: Documentation is important. Clients must assemble medical records verifying their diagnosis, details of asbestos exposure (work history, environments, etc), and any pertinent family or neighborhood exposure cases.

File the lawsuit: The attorney will draft and file the legal complaint in the suitable court, naming the responsible parties, which may include employers or makers of asbestos-containing products.

Settlement and settlement: Once the lawsuit is filed, parties might enter settlement negotiations. Lots of mesothelioma cases settle before trial to avoid prolonged court procedures.

Trial: If negotiations fail, the case might proceed to trial. Here, both parties will provide proof and witness testimonies, after which a judge or jury will render a decision.
5. Compensation: What to Expect
Compensation from a mesothelioma lawsuit can help cover a range of expenses. Classifications of damages typically granted consist of:
Medical costs: Past and future medical costs connected to cancer treatment.Lost salaries: Compensation for income lost due to inability to work.Pain and suffering: Damages for physical discomfort and emotional distress triggered by the diagnosis and treatment.Compensatory damages: In cases of gross negligence, additional compensatory damages may be granted to punish the responsible parties.
The amount of compensation can vary widely based on elements such as the seriousness of the illness, the financial situation of accountable parties, and the strength of the evidence supplied.
